Shirley shows chess depth

Shirley Boys’ High School, the winner of "The Press' .schools’ chess tournament last year, has an entireiv inew team of six this year, I but it appears mat 1 still has considerable strength. In the opening round of | the A grade last week, j Shirley accounted for Si Bede’s without losing a ’game. Shirley’s strongest lopposition is likely to come from the two Christchurch ■ teams . ’ The Christchurch A team, tied bv Warwick Norton, joint wipner of the Canterbuiv scnoolpupiis’ tournament in the May holidays, ha> a 5-1 victory against Christ’s' College. j College's win was sained on board three where Martin Carrell, who gained experience in last year’s tournament, beat Donald Anderson. The first round in the B grade was notable for the j success of the rural schools. Darfield made an auspicious debut in the tournament, beating Burnside B — a traditionally strong chess school — decisively. In the > same zone, Rangiora dropped jonh one game against St i Andrew’s. in the second zone. Ash- I I burton accounted for Middle- i ton Grange and Heaton.
